    just a query.....
    i bought a 2x36W PL light abt 3 months ago,
    normally how long such a bulb last?? as in brightness, light intensity....
    how do we gauge when to change....
    assuming on for 8hrs a day, normally how long u guys will use b4 changing 1 new bulb??

    3 months still ok,
    six months do this simple test...

    first, buy a new one[keep as emergency spare]
    use this to replace one of the old ones, [turn on and compare with the old with new]
    not much diff means you can put back the old one and keep spare till next couple of months to test again.

    depending on brands most need to be replaced every year.
    if kiam siap or puurse tight change one at a time. good idea to do this too because light change affects algae growth if you don't up the co2 with stronger light.
